What's the surest sign a story has "made it" into the collective consciousness of the masses?  A Taiwanese animation video from the folks at Next Media Animation, of course!  This time, the NMA folks turn their attention to ESPN caving into the NFL and backing out of their partnership with PBS.  

It's satirical yes, (although I can picture Roger Goodell swimming in a pile of cash with Mickey Mouse) but it makes a serious point.  If Taiwanese Animation realizes ESPN's news division will always play second fiddle to its business and entertainment interests, it's a reality everyone has to face… for better and worse.
